Why the Water Cap Matters at Wholesale Scale
When a single cap design is multiplied across tens of thousands or millions of units, even a small flaw becomes expensive. A water cap that seals inconsistently can lead to leakage during transport, customer returns, or contamination concerns that damage a brand's reputation. At the same time, a cap that is overbuilt for the application adds unnecessary material cost across every unit produced. Buyers purchasing at wholesale level need to balance reliability with cost efficiency, since the cap is one of the few components touched on every single bottle that leaves the facility.
Core Factors to Evaluate Before Ordering
Choosing a water cap supplier for bulk orders comes down to a short list of factors that matter more than design or branding extras. Compatibility with existing bottling line equipment is the first concern, since a cap that doesn't match current capping machinery can halt production entirely. Material safety certification is equally important, as any cap in direct contact with drinking water typically needs to meet recognized food-contact material standards. Consistency across production batches also matters at scale; a cap that performs well in a sample order but varies in thread depth or seal tightness once manufactured in bulk creates downstream problems for the bottler. Finally, lead time and minimum order quantities affect how a wholesale relationship fits into existing inventory planning, particularly for companies that need predictable restocking cycles.
Comparing Common Water Cap Materials
Material choice affects both cost and performance, and wholesale buyers benefit from comparing options side by side before committing to a large order.
| Material | Typical Use Case | Key Consideration |
|---|---|---|
| HDPE (High-Density Polyethylene) | Standard still water bottles | Cost-effective, widely compatible with existing capping lines |
| PP (Polypropylene) | Carbonated or pressurized water bottles | Offers added rigidity to handle internal pressure |
| Tamper-evident PP with break ring | Retail-bound bottled water | Provides visible proof of an unopened seal for consumer trust |
| Sports cap variants | On-the-go or single-serve water bottles | Adds a flip-top or pull spout for convenience without changing base seal |
Matching Water Cap Specifications to Bottle Neck Standards
Wholesale buyers also need to confirm that the water cap specification aligns with the bottle neck finish already in use, since mismatched thread counts or diameters will not seal correctly regardless of material quality. Most bottled water producers work within a small number of standard neck finishes, and confirming this specification with both the bottle supplier and the cap supplier before placing a bulk order prevents costly mismatches once production begins. Buyers switching bottle suppliers or introducing a new bottle size should request physical samples of both the bottle and the cap together rather than relying on written specifications alone.
Working With Suppliers on Bulk Orders
Negotiating a wholesale water cap order typically involves more than agreeing on a unit price. Reliable suppliers should be able to provide documentation confirming food-contact safety, consistent batch testing results, and clear lead times for repeat orders throughout the year. For buyers planning volume into 2026, it is worth discussing how a supplier handles seasonal demand spikes, since bottled water consumption often increases during warmer months and a cap shortage at the wrong time can stall an entire production run. Establishing a secondary or backup supplier relationship, even at smaller volume, is a common practice among experienced wholesale buyers to avoid being dependent on a single source.
Sustainability Considerations for 2026 Orders
Many bottled water brands are under increasing pressure to reduce plastic use, and the water cap is often part of that conversation since it remains attached to the bottle in many regions due to environmental regulations. Buyers planning 2026 orders should ask suppliers about lightweighting options, which reduce the amount of plastic used per cap without compromising seal integrity, as well as whether recycled-content materials are available and compatible with existing food-contact requirements.
Frequently Asked Questions
What is the most common water cap material for bottled water?
HDPE and PP are the most widely used materials for water caps, with the choice depending on whether the bottle is for still or carbonated water.
Does a wholesale water cap order require a minimum quantity?
Most suppliers set minimum order quantities for bulk pricing, and these vary based on cap design, material, and whether tooling adjustments are needed.
How do I confirm a water cap will fit my existing bottle line?
Request physical samples of the cap matched to your current bottle neck finish and test them on your actual capping equipment before placing a full wholesale order.
Are tamper-evident features standard on wholesale water caps?
Tamper-evident designs with a break ring are common for retail bottled water but are typically offered as a specific option rather than a universal default, so this should be confirmed with the supplier.
Can wholesale water cap orders include lightweight or recycled-content options?
Many suppliers now offer lightweighted or recycled-content caps, though availability depends on the supplier and whether the material still meets food-contact safety standards for the intended water product.
